About Norangpura

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Norangpura village is 071556. Norangpura village is located in Khetri tehsil of Jhunjhunun district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Khetri (tehsildar office) and 59km away from district headquarter Jhunjhunun. As per 2009 stats, Norangpura village is also a gram panchayat.

The total geographical area of village is 661 hectares. Norangpura has a total population of 1,691 peoples, out of which male population is 859 while female population is 832. Literacy rate of norangpura village is 61.56% out of which 73.69% males and 49.04% females are literate. There are about 336 houses in norangpura village. Pincode of norangpura village locality is 332716.

Khetri is nearest town to norangpura for all major economic activities, which is approximately 30km away.

Population of Norangpura

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,691 859 832
Literate Population 1,041 633 408
Illiterate Population 650 226 424
